Output 1397ab253efbfeed3f84f37037bf07ce6a9efc480a8334193333b5f8ee230456:4

value
140369
script pubkey
OP_HASH160 OP_PUSHBYTES_20 8314133699082c37ae19e9f2d2b4c6929fcb0757 OP_EQUAL
address
3De6VWgcwUPKviaNZzZt7o2FsifJ7sbVZN
transaction
1397ab253efbfeed3f84f37037bf07ce6a9efc480a8334193333b5f8ee230456
confirmations
222409
spent
true